Cercle Brugge: Tactical Approach and Current Form
Cercle Brugge come into this match with a solid run of results, having lost just one of their last five games. Their recent form has been built on a resilient defensive setup, coupled with quick transitions to exploit spaces in the attacking third. The team typically lines up in a 4-3-3 formation, relying on the pace of their wingers and the creative spark from their midfielders to unlock opposition defenses. Statistically, Cercle Brugge have averaged 48% possession over their last five games but have been incredibly effective in their pressing, with 12.5 successful high-press actions per match. This is key to their game plan, as they look to disrupt Brugge's build-up play and hit them on the counter.
Key players for Cercle Brugge include their captain, who provides leadership in the heart of the defense, and their prolific winger, who has contributed with 3 goals and 2 assists in the last 5 games. However, a major concern for the team is the absence of their key midfielder, who is serving a suspension. This will likely force coach Yves Vanderhaeghe to adjust the midfield balance, which could disrupt the fluidity of their attack. Nevertheless, their recent defensive solidity, including a commendable xG conceded of just 0.88 per match, should keep them competitive.
Brugge: Tactical Approach and Current Form
Brugge have been on a rollercoaster ride in recent weeks, with an inconsistent record in their last five matches, having won two, lost two, and drawn one. Their tactical approach has been dominated by a 4-2-3-1 formation, focusing on controlled possession and high pressing. They enjoy a possession-heavy game, averaging 58% in their last five outings, and their ability to dominate the ball in the final third has resulted in 5.2 shots per match within the penalty box. However, their inability to convert chances has been a recurring issue, with their xG standing at just 1.47 per game during this period.
One of the standout players for Brugge is their star forward, who has scored 4 goals in the last 5 matches, but his inconsistency in finishing could be a critical factor against Cercle Brugge’s defensive setup. The return of their playmaking midfielder, who has missed the last few games through injury, will be crucial. He is the focal point of their attacking transitions and will be tasked with breaking down Cercle Brugge's defensive lines. If Brugge can get their finishing right and maintain their possession dominance, they will pose a significant threat.
Head-to-Head: History and Psychology
The head-to-head between these two teams has been a fairly even contest in recent seasons. Over the last five encounters, Brugge have managed two wins, while Cercle Brugge has secured one victory, with two matches ending in draws. However, the psychological aspect of this match cannot be overlooked. Brugge, as the more established team, will be under pressure to claim all three points to stay in the hunt for European competition, whereas Cercle Brugge will be motivated to take advantage of their rivals' vulnerability. The last encounter ended in a 2-2 draw, a testament to how competitive this fixture has been. It's a rivalry that often defies form, and this match will surely be no different.
